In this paper,geometric models of throttling parts with three different structures are established based on the characteris-tics of pressure proportioner.The numerical simulation of the pro-portioner with different throttling parts is carried out by using Flu-ent software to analyze the pressure distribution and velocity dis-tribution under design conditions.And through experiments,the mixing ratio and pressure loss of the three proportioner with differ-ent structures are studied.The influence of the structure character-istics of different pressure proportioner on the main performance parameters are analyzed.In the comparison of experimental and simulation results,the relative error of pressure loss under high flow rate is within±10%,which provides a theoretical reference for the design calculation,selection and structure optimization of the proportional mixer.
